An equation is formed when two equal expressions are equated together with the help of an equal sign '='.
Multiply the first equation by 2 and the other equation by -3. Therefore, the two equations will be,
14x - 18y = -60
9x + 18y = -9
Add the two equations,
14x - 18y + 9x + 18y = -9 -60
23x = -69
x = -3
Substitute the value of x in any one of the two given equations,
7(-3) - 9y =-30
-21 - 9y = -30
-9y = -9
y = 1
Hence, the solution of the system of equation is (-3,1).
